2',7-Dihydroxy-4'-methoxyisoflavan, a natural chemical compound within the isoflavonoid group, is characterized by the presence of two hydroxyl groups at the 2' and 7 positions and a methoxy group at the 4' position on its structure. It is commonly found in a variety of plants and vegetables and is known for its antioxidant and anti-inflammatory properties. 2',7-DIHYDROXY-4'-METHOXYISOFLAVAN has garnered interest for its potential health benefits, including disease prevention and treatment, as well as its possible role in cancer prevention, treatment, and hormone-related conditions due to its structural resemblance to estrogen. As a result, 2',7-dihydroxy-4'-methoxyisoflavan is a promising candidate for further research in the fields of natural products and medicinal chemistry.

Total syntheses of (±)-vestitol and bolusanthin III using a wittig strategy

Luniwal, Amarjit,Erhardt, Paul W.

, p. 1605 - 1607 (2011/08/03)

An intramolecular Wittig olefination was utilized to -produce the key isoflav-3-ene intermediate needed to prepare (±)-vestitol and bolusanthin III in ca. 30% and 20% respective yields after eight steps. Georg Thieme Verlag Stuttgart ? New York.

o-Quinone methide based approach to isoflavans: application to the total syntheses of equol, 3′-hydroxyequol and vestitol

Gharpure, Santosh J.,Sathiyanarayanan,Jonnalagadda, Prasad

, p. 2974 - 2978 (2008/09/20)

A concise strategy is developed for the synthesis of isoflavans employing a Diels-Alder reaction between o-quinone methides and aryl-substituted enol ethers followed by reductive cleavage of the acetal group. The method is extended towards the total syntheses of equol, 3′-hydroxyequol and vestitol.
